PPG 28614
I have two variants, prime and yellower. Have not tried either.
OEM code SAR, 1241

hope this helps

The paint place I'm using can't find Whitehall Beige. When I had my car painted, I think they just used the old BG-4 code from BMC and found a match. I guess that one doesn't work anymore. I tried the Ditzler 21931 code from a list on MM, but they can't cross that with anything. They tried using the paint scanner camera they have, but it only gets to about 89% and it keeps coming out either blueish or too brown. Does anyone have a code for it for any modern paint formulas?
